背景 Dubbo是阿里巴巴开源的一个高性能优秀的服务框架现(已加入Apache项目中),使得应用可通过高性能的 RPC 实现服务的输出和输入功能,可以和 Spring...
背景 Dubbo是阿里巴巴开源的一个高性能优秀的服务框架现(已加入Apache项目中),使得应用可通过高性能的 RPC 实现服务的输出和输入功能,可以和 Spring...
Sentinel是阿里巴巴开源的限流器熔断器,并且带有可视化操作界面。 在日常开发中,限流功能时常被使用,用于对某些接口进行限流熔断,譬如限制单位时间内接口访问次数;或者按照...
一、 插件安装 二、 插件推荐 1. Alibaba Java Coding Guidelines 阿里巴巴编码规约扫描代码,检查代码,养成良好的代码风格与习惯 2. Lom...
File->Settings->Version Control->Git->点击TEST测试是否安装Git,如果没有点击安装image.png Github中添加账户imag...
1. 数据结构定义 数据结构是计算机存储、组织数据的方式。数据结构是指相互之间存在一种或多种特定关系的数据元素的集合。通常情况下,精心选择的数据结构可以带来更高的运行或...
1. 分布式数据库的CAP原理 Consistency:强一致性 Availability:可用性 Partitition tolerance:分区容错性 只能三选二:CA...
1. 64位和32位的区别 运行能力不同。64位可以一次性可以处理8个字节的数据量,而32位一次性只可以处理4个字节的数据量,因此64位比32位的运行能力提高了一倍。 内存...
1. 路由器和交换机的区别 工作层次不同:交换机比路由器更简单,路由器比交换机能获取更多信息,交换机工作在数据链路层,而路由器工作在网络层 数据转发所依据的对象不同。交换机...
1. JSP和Servlet区别 JSP是Servlet技术的扩展,本质上就是Servlet的简易方式。JSP编译后是“类servlet”。Servlet和JSP最主要...
1. Spring Spring的模块大概分为6个。分别是: 2. spring框架的优点 Spring是一个轻量级的DI和AOP容器框架,在项目的中的使用越来越广泛,它...
1. JVM(https://blog.csdn.net/qq_41701956/article/details/81664921) JVM的作用:解释运行字节码程序消除平...
1. 进程和线程的区别 进程是资源分配的最小单位,线程是CPU调度的最小单位,一个程序至少一个进程,一个进程至少一个线程。 进程:是并发执行的程序在执行过程中分配和管...
1. 数据库设计准则 第一范式:列的原子性,列不可拆分。 第二范式:1)表必须有一个主键;2)没有包含在主键的列必须完全依赖于主键,而不是部分依赖 第三范式:非主键列必须直...
1. Collection 和 Collections Collection是集合类的上级接口,继承他的接口主要有Set 和List. Collections是针对集合类的...
1. Java的安全性 使用引用取代了指针,指针的功能强大,但是也容易造成错误,如数组越界问题。 拥有一套异常处理机制,使用关键字 throw、throws、try、cat...